The developer steering tag follows coverage of how platform owners shape app distribution, payments, and the rules developers must work within. Its current focus is Apple’s Supreme Court appeal in the Epic Games App Store dispute, including a contempt ruling, a proposed 27% payment fee, and questions about whether a company can technically comply with an injunction while preserving the same economic barriers. The story connects Fortnite and iPhone payments to wider concerns about platform governance and enforcement. It is relevant to developers and ecosystem operators as court decisions in one app-store dispute may influence how digital platforms manage competition and developer access.
